General Presentation


Alternative Sociale Association (ASA)

Is a nongovernmental, apolitical, and non-profit organization initiated in 1997 by a group of students at the Social Work Faculty of "Alexandru Ioan Cuza" University in Iasi.

Mission

Alternative Sociale Association works to protect and promote human rights through prevention activities, assistance, training, research and advocacy.

Vision

A world in which human rights are respected.

Objectives

  • Development of prevention activities in the area of protecting human rights
  • Assistance for persons in difficult situations
  • Optimizing professional skills in professionals working on promoting and defending human rights
  • Informing and involving local communities in the activities developed by the association
  • Researching psycho-social phenomenon
  • Law analysis and proposals for lege ferenda
  • Lobby and advocacy activities in the area of human rights
  • Development of inter-institutional collaboration for defending human rights
  • Offering consultancy for public and private institutions
  • Promoting the professional status of the psychologist and of the social worker

The actions of Alternative Sociale aim for activities regarding prevention, assistance, training, research, and advocacy in the following areas:

  • Human trafficking
  • Child victims of abuse/neglect
  • Elder persons
  • Relapse prevention
  • Domestic violence
  • Labor exploitation
  • Promoting non-custodial alternatives
  • Raising public security
  • Negative effects of migration
  • Training for professionals
  • Promotion of volunteering
  • Fund raising
  • Organizational development
  • Studies and research
  • Lobby and advocacy
  • Juvenile delinquency
  • Strengthening organizational capacity in institutions acting for promoting and defending human rights
  • Conceiving and editing manuals and information materials
  • Offering scholarships and grants
